NYISO filing replaces Class Year with a cluster study process
The filing describes how cost allocation groups are defined under the cluster study process compared with Class Year.
NYISO historically allocated interconnection facility and system upgrade costs through its Class Year process, in which a defined group of projects accepted or declined cost allocations together. Its compliance with Order No. 2023 moves the study framework toward clusters.
The two constructs share a premise, that costs are shared among a group, but differ in how the group is formed and when a project can leave without disturbing the others. The practical difference is felt in restudy exposure: the more permeable the group, the more often surviving projects see revised numbers.
New York's siting and permitting regime interacts with this. A project that clears study but cannot clear local approval within the applicable window imposes its exit on the rest of the group.
For a developer, the transitional cycles are the ones to read closely, because they contain positions formed under both sets of expectations.
What to watch: how the compliance tariff treats projects that accepted Class Year allocations and are still constructing.
